Injection Molded Acrylic Design Guide

Injection molding PMMA (Acrylic) Part design must account for PMMA's properties, particularly its transparency and flow limitations.
Item Description
Rib Design Ribs should be about 60% of wall thickness to enhance part strength, with a slight draft angle to allow easy removal from the mold.
Boss Design Design bosses with a diameter 2-3 times the screw diameter and a wall thickness 60% of the main wall to prevent sink marks, considering PMMA's shrinkage rate of 0.2-1%.
Snap-Fit Design Use short, wide snap-fit cantilevers with generous radii, as PMMA's elongation at break is generally between 2-5%.
Hole Design Maintain a minimum distance of 1.5 times the hole diameter from the edge to prevent cracking, given PMMA's notched impact strength varies between 10-20 J/m.
Wall Thickness Transitions Use a 3:1 transition ratio to minimize stress concentrations, as abrupt changes affect PMMA's uniform cooling and shrinkage.
Tolerance Commercial tolerances are 0.1 to 0.325 mm for parts under 160 mm, while fine tolerances (0.045 to 0.145 mm) suit smaller parts (≤100 mm).
Assembly Considerations Design features for assembly, accounting for PMMA's thermal expansion and potential for stress cracking during joining.
